Nell Mercer Eddleman

of Perryville, AR

November 2, 1921 - November 8, 2014

Nell Mercer Eddleman, 93, of Aubrey, Arkansas passed away on Saturday, November 8, 2014 while a resident at Perry County Nursing Center, Perryville, Arkansas. She was born November 2, 1921 in Perry County, Tenneessee. She was preceded in death by her parents, Jess and Myrtle Whitwell Mercer, her husband, James Woodrow Eddleman of fifty years, seven brothers, Elmer, Paul, Clint (Doc), Edger (Dude), Dick, Rex and Donald Mercer, one sister, Faye Mercer Eddleman. She is survived by two sisters, Jimmie Aydelotte, of Chicago, Il; and Jeanette Powell, of White Lake, MI; her children, Nina Johnson, of Hot Springs Village, Kenneth Eddleman, of Germantown, TN; Mike Eddleman, of Conroe, TX; and Steve Eddleman, of Bryant, AR; eight grandchildren and thirteen great grandchildren.
She was a devoted wife and mother. A faithful member of the Aubrey Church of Christ, and had a deep love for her family and church. She loved spending hours visiting with family and friends or being a caregiver to whomever needed help. The wife of a farmer, she loved the outdoors and her flowers, especially Iris.

The family asks in lieu of flowers, donations be made to American Diabetes Association, 212 Natural Resources Drive, Little Rock, Arkansas, 72205 or the Charity of your choice.

Services for Nell Eddleman will be held Wednesday, November 12, 2014 at 2:00 P.M. at Roller Citizens Funeral Home, Marianna. Visitation will be held prior to services at 1:00 P.M. also at Roller Citizens Funeral Home. Burial will follow at Marianna Memorial Park. Roller Citizens Funeral Home, Marianna (870) 295- 2528 has charge of arrangements.
